New Low-Cost Diesel For Stilo Range

Published: 14th June 2002
Fiat Stilo


Stilo, Fiat Auto’s new mid-size hatchback, has just become available with an economical 80 bhp version of the company’s widely acclaimed common rail direct injection turbodiesel engine. This 1.9 litre JTD unit can now be ordered on the entry-level 5-door Active version. A 115 bhp JTD engine has been available on both 3 and 5-door versions since Stilo was introduced here earlier this year.

Fiat Auto’s common rail diesel engines provide both reliability and refinement along with significantly improved performance, a reduction in combustion noise, and reduced fuel consumption and exhaust emissions compared with conventional diesel engines.

In this economy state of tune the 1.9 JTD engine delivers 80 bhp at 4000 rpm, and a substantial 144 lb.ft of torque at just 1500 rpm – characteristics which make the vehicle particularly flexible and easy to drive. Top speed is 105 mph, with acceleration from 0-62 mph in 13.3 seconds. Fuel consumption is low, and official figures show that the Stilo JTD achieves 51.4 mpg over a combined cycle. CO2 emissions are 146 g/km.

Closely related to the 115 bhp 1.9 JTD engine already available in the range, the 80 bhp version differs in that it does not have an intercooler and is fitted with a fixed geometry turbine instead of a variable geometry unit. Both engines comply with Euro 3 exhaust emissions standards.

The price of the 1.9 JTD 80 Active 5-door is as follows:

Basic Price
£9936.17
VAT
£1738.83
Total
£11,675.00
OTR Changes
£160.00
Total OTR
£11,835.00

In addition, all Stilo versions benefit from Fiat Auto’s current customer offer of 0% finance over 3 years with a 40% deposit. The Stilo range now starts at £9995 (OTR).

All Fiat cars come with a comprehensive three-year warranty and roadside service package, made up of a two-year unlimited mileage manufacturer warranty, a third year dealer warranty with a mileage limit of 60,000 from the date of first registration, and three years’ Fiat AA Assurance cover, consisting of Roadside Assistance, Home Start, Relay, Relay Plus and European cover.
